概括
智能医疗保健系统可以通过整合跨领域的数据来提高生活质量. 一个新的框架使用分类学和软件架构来定义,集成和关联各种物联网 (IoT) 数据实时.
科学领域:
- 计算机科学 计算机科学
- 医疗信息学 医疗信息学
- 物联网 (IoT) 的物联网 (IoT) 的物联网.
背景情况:
- 物联网 (IoT) 正在迅速扩展到医疗保健领域,创建智能医疗保健系统.
- 当前的智能医疗保健应用程序往往缺乏跨域数据集成,限制了它们的上下文化能力.
- 现有的数据定义结构要么过于域特定,要么过于通用,阻碍了有效的数据相关性.
研究的目的:
- 展示一种新的分类学和软件架构如何增强智能医疗保健系统.
- 解决缺乏定义,整合和关联不同物联网领域数据的共同标准的问题.
- 通过跨领域数据利用,提高智能医疗保健应用程序的上下文化.
主要方法:
- 利用最近开发的分类学来定义各种物联网领域的数据.
- 采用了一种拟议的软件架构来整合和关联异质数据.
- 实现实时复杂事件处理,用于动态数据分析.
- 通过一个案例研究来说明解决方案的可行性.
主要成果:
- 拟议的分类学允许在智能环境中定义来自各种领域的数据.
- 软件架构促进了这些跨领域数据的集成和相关性.
- 该框架支持智能医疗保健应用程序的增强上下文化.
- 一个案例研究证实了拟议方法的实际可行性.
结论:
- 提出的框架为克服智能医疗保健中的数据孤岛提供了可行的解决方案.
- 通过统一的分类学和架构集成各种物联网数据,显著提高了智能应用程序的能力.
- 这种方法为更智能和更具背景意识的医疗保健系统铺平了道路,最终有利于患者的生活质量.

Integrated Healthcare System
2.5K
An integrated healthcare system (IHS) is a set of organizations that provides for or arranges to provide coordinated and continuous service to a defined population. The IHS takes responsibility for that particular population's health status and outcome, both clinically and fiscally. An integrated healthcare system is a well-organized, well-coordinated, and collaborative network.
